Multiple Arrests Made After Body Found in Concrete and Crawl Space Graves in Colorado

TL;DR Summary
Two suspects have been arrested in Aurora, Colorado, after police found a missing man buried in concrete in a home's crawlspace. Casie Bock has been charged with accessory to homicide, while Haskel Leroy Crawford has been charged with first-degree murder. The victim, Karl Beaman, had been missing since last summer. Bock told police that Crawford, her ex-boyfriend, murdered Beaman and forced her to help bury the body. The investigation began after a tip was received that Beaman was buried in the crawl space.
